Review of a Panasonic TH-42pz81B
Not a bad bit of plasma kit, a bit expensive but with panasonic you pay for the name,
The picture very good, blacks a quite decent, glare of the screen is very low, in High Def full 1080p the picture is very sharp and coulorful, movies are cool like being in the cinema but without the idoit eating skittles next to you. Sound quality is good but if your paying this for a TV you can afford home Cinema system.
I found unlike My Lg 42inch plasma this TV works really well with Xbox360 and Playstation 3 console, well up there with LCD for gaming.
Good HDMI connection and other ports, would recommend this TV, the only way your going to get anything better is to stump up sony prices
==Panasonic TH-42PZ81B==
The First Plasma TV enabled to receive freesat (free digital satellite broadcastings). The Freesat is the satellite TV service soon to be launched in UK. It is the Free to air High Definition TV Channels service. The full HD 42" Plasma is the best among its peers. The great feature rich TV to be best buy though the price is a bit high.
===Analysis===
* Full HD 42 inch plasma Screen is always going to be the best to have ... ...with the picture is just great. The picture details are more visible than any other TV, like the Shadows, the grey scale etc. The highest of the contrast ratio makes the Picture clearity such that the things seem to be moving in front of you. Its truely a real cinema experience in itself. Look and feel of TV is good with its full glossy black body. The control Bottons are hidden behind the glossy black flip cover.

The Panasonic TH-42pZ81B is an extremely impressive piece of audio visual equipment, however it dose suffer from an extremely high price coupled slight image blurring during the most frenetic action scenes, whilst several other televisions in its class can be said to suffer from similar problems they all sport considerably lower price tags than this model.
